Alesis upgrade popular QS synthesizer models


Index Keyboard-SectionEmail to Pro-Music-Newssearch-site, guestbook and classifiedsmain index pro-music-news
At Musikmesse Prolight+Sound 2002 Alesis show upgrades to the popular QS6 and QS8 synthesizer models, which have been announced at winter NAMM in Anaheim.
The most important enhancement to both the QS6.2 and QS8.2 is the addition of 4MB of internal Flash memory. This not only gives the synthesizer 4MB of new sounds, but allows for the creation of custom sample sets to be available directly from the keyboard. The more obvious upgrade to both the QS6.2 and QS8.2 is the sleek, "industrial" silver design exterior. In addition, both models have been updated with the new Alesis 24-bit digital-to-analog converters for enhanced sound quality.
